+2009-04-24  Ulrich Drepper  <drepper@redhat.com>
+
+	[BZ #10093]
+	* iconv/gconv_simple.c (BODY for UTF-8 to INTERNAL): Don't accept
+	UTF-16 surrogates.
+
+	* locale/programs/locarchive.c (enlarge_archive): Conserve address
+	space when temporarily mapping the whole content of the old file.
+
+	[BZ #10100]
+	* misc/hsearch_r.c (hsearch_r): Add back ensurance that hval is
+	not zero.
+
+2009-04-24  Jakub Jelinek  <jakub@redhat.com>
+
+	* iconvdata/sjis.c (BODY): Don't advance inptr before
+	STANDARD_FROM_LOOP_ERR_HANDLER (2) for 2 byte invalid input.
+	Use STANDARD_FROM_LOOP_ERR_HANDLER with 2 instead of 1 for
+	two byte chars.
+
+2009-04-24  Ulrich Drepper  <drepper@redhat.com>
+
+	* locale/locarchive.h (struct locarhandle): Rename len field to
+	mmaped and add new reserved field.
+	* locale/programs/locarchive.c (RESERVE_MMAP_SIZE): Define.
+	(create_archive): Reserve address space and then map file into it.
+	(open_archive): Likewise.
+	(file_data_available_p): New function.
+	(compare_from_file): New function.
+	(close_archive): Adjust to member name changes.
+	(add_locale): Before comparing locale data, check it is mapped.
+	Otherwise fall back to reading from the file.
+
+2009-04-23  H.J. Lu  <hongjiu.lu@intel.com>
+
+	* stdio-common/psiginfo.c: Include <errno.h>.
